CPU utilization approaches 100% in Windows NT CPU utilization approaches 100% in Windows NT
Symptom:
In Performance Monitor, when monitoring the TAPISRV
process, CPU utilization approaches 100%.
Cause:
There are several Q-Articles on Microsoft's web site that
reference possible reasons for the CPU utilization to spike.
Solution:
Verify under Task Manager, Processes what process is really
spiking the CPU Utilization.
Make sure you are on the latest service pack for Windows
NT.
To correct this problem, go into Control Panel,
Network. Highlight the Digi adapter and select Properties. Change
the Close Timeout settings in the Ports Properties of the driver from its
default of 25msec to 0msec. Make this change for each port. Reboot
the system for this change to take effect.
Verify that there are no modems configured for RAS that are no longer connected
to the system or are powered off.
Reference Microsoft Knowledge Base Document
Q181490 and Q154387.
